Garuda88 has dominated the online gaming scene like no other. With a legacy built on skill, this legendary player has become a symbol of victory in the digital realm. From action-packed games to thought-provoking https://adrianajazl675298.wikicommunications.com/5065972/garuda88_the_king_of_online_gaming